Past the Veil : Half-Elf Warlock Character Notions

Delving beyond the typical heroic narrative, Elven-Human Spellcaster characters offer a captivating fusion of elegance and mysterious power. Imagine a aristocratic scion, covertly bound to a formidable entity after a desperate encounter, their lineage granting them both perception and vulnerability to the otherworldly forces they wield. Alternatively, a cunning urchin, abandoned and claimed by a eccentric fey lord, could manifest as a unpredictable agent of change . Perhaps a disgraced scholar, delving into occult knowledge, forges a pact to recover their lost standing , becoming a unwilling champion or a twisted antagonist. These are just a few of the diverse possibilities when you combine the innate charm of a Half-Elf with the alluring power of a Warlock.
